Well, I have almost managed to go an entire month without weighing my self. I have lost weight in the past and previously weighed myself every day. I'm hoping this new approach will help me not get too exited or discouraged on a daily basis. I started at 275 lbs at 5 ft 11 in and am working at getting to 200 lbs eventually. On the 31st of this month I will post my weight loss for the month. Hope all this sweating pays off.

last time i weighed in was early June at the doctor's office for a routine checkup...needless to say, that weigh in was quite a shock to me. I knew i was putting on weight but figured as long as i didnt step on the scale it didnt count...lol...yeah well, it was then i decided i had enough of not facing the facts ...i mean, seriously, you would think that when i had to dig out my three-sizes-too-big clothes that i had packed away, because nothing else was fitting, i would have faced the reality of the situation....or when i found myself buying the stretchy old lady pants that my mom used to wear (and i swore i would never own)
Well, the reality of the situation today is that i have once again...and for the final time because they are going to the Goodwill... Packed up the three -sizes-too-big pants...along with the old lady stretchy pants....and am sliding into the three sizes smaller clothes. I still have a few sizes to lose, but that will come.
I have no idea how much i have lost. I decided to let my clothes speak for themselves. I am one of those people who used to weigh myself 3-4-5 times a day, sliding the scale around on the floor, carrying it from room to room, hoping i would weigh an ounce less. My moods were dependent on what the scale had to say, so i figured this time around, i am not going to weigh until i am good and ready to weigh. I suspect that i might have lost about 30 lbs thus far, based on my clothing....but i know if i stepped on the scale and it said 25lbs....i would be upset...thats just me...i dont know when i will weigh...maybe it will be my christmas present to me....we'll see!
